Tips For Choosing Wedding Locations In Vermont

By Gwen Lowe


When couples start shopping for wedding venues, more often they fall in love with the beauty of the place and sign the contract before considering more important and practical issues. But unless the place is just magical and you are willing to take risks with it, you should never choose a venue for your big day until you have the approximate number of expected guests and your budget. You also need to decide whether to host the main ceremony and reception in the same place. Below are tips to help you choose ideal wedding locations in Vermont.

It is usually very important to decide the type of ceremony you want whether church based function or traditional one. This will point you in the right direction as far as choice of venue is concerned. For church functions, the ideal venue would be church hall. For traditional weddings, the options are unlimited. You can opt for garden function or hall depending on your preference.

The venue you choose will be determined by the number of guests you expect. Prepare a guest list beforehand. This will help you choose a venue with the right size. The right size will have sufficient space for your guests. Consider where majority of your guest live. You will be able to save costs on transportation and accommodation by choosing a location convenient for your guests.

Budget is another factor you must consider. You should discuss with your partner how much you are willing to cough out on venue. If you are madly in love with a venue and you are operating on a tight budget, there are ways to get around it. One way is to slash budget from other things.

Consider the time of year you plan to get married. Once you have decided on a date, visit the venue to check the availability of space. Couples who are flexible on dates and seasons have many options to choose from. It is wise to visit a venue on a Saturday when people are getting married. This helps you identify the different types of wedding arrangements that suit the venue. You will have a clear picture of what to expect during your ceremony.

You must also make up your mind whether to use one venue for both the main function and the reception. Even though this is one way of cutting costs, it will depend on the capacity of the venue to host the two events. To make your work even easier, you can also run online search. Most wedding venues nowadays have websites where you can find all the details you are looking for. This has made work very easy for couples.

If you know other couples who celebrated their weddings in the recent past, you can always ask them for recommendations of perfect venues around. Other than other couples, you can also seek referrals from vendors you have chosen like photographer, deejay, florist or caterer. They will be in a good position to give you recommendation since they perform in various venues on a very regular basis.

It is true that finding a good venue for your big day can be a daunting task. Fortunately, the choices are incredibly diverse. Couples have the options of choosing banquet halls, country clubs, small restaurants, cafes and many others.
